The New York Times Connections puzzle for September 3, 2025, puzzle #815, is now live. Many players found this one tricky. Early clues like “WED,” “NES,” and “DAY” hinted at weekdays. But that was just a distraction.

This puzzle tested players on word meanings and pop culture. It also featured clever wordplay. Let’s break down the groupings, hints, and answers for today’s game.

Full Breakdown of Today’s NYT Connections Puzzle

This puzzle had four distinct word groups. Each had a unique theme. Some were easier to guess than others.

The yellow group was the simplest. Its theme was “Beginning.” The answers were: birth, dawn, genesis, and start.

The green group was about joining. It included: bond, combine, fuse, and wed.

The blue group referenced TV-related abbreviations from the 1980s. These were: ALF, MTV, NES, and VHS.

The toughest was the purple group. It had the theme “May ____.” The answers were: day, flower, fly, and pole.

According to CNET, the puzzle teased players at first. But once you moved past the misleading clues, patterns became clear. This made the game both challenging and fun.

Tips to Solve NYT Connections Effectively

To succeed at Connections, think beyond direct meanings. Words often hide double meanings. For example, “wed” can mean a wedding or to combine.

Group clues mentally. Start with the most obvious ones. Match similar ideas first.

Keep in mind that NYT sometimes uses old-school pop culture. Terms like VHS or ALF might trick younger players.
